Transaction d26a33c2cd3c1bb0edb059b33b6d18ead877d1ba50f80c2fa75fc95e841cdd27

block
167c3a6043a414a420adb1cab6ac250a70aec8319db1f1f1303b62c7dbedcaf7

1 Input

21 Outputs